no- no mouse traps
take a small plastic bucket, fill it with some of his food at the bottom (take away any other food). put a small ladder (like in some cages) from the floor to the outside of the bucket.
leave overnight and check in the morning....
this has never failed me- and i have lost lots and lots of hamsters.
they go for the food and can't get back out of the bucket.
good luck.0 -
